Output 23f71866d88499011fd976401056e4585926ecea282bb0ec6d1f639d7a33bd54:1

value
62947015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4604815e037678228fd13da8eacd2d60bf01f94 OP_EQUAL
address
3M3xWyRBySwP8KvrPw8eojfUhbZ4YjbuAR
transaction
23f71866d88499011fd976401056e4585926ecea282bb0ec6d1f639d7a33bd54
confirmations
421261
spent
true